(The Group’s Comments) Vodafone Net Profit Rises to QR 43.5 Million in Q1 2019

 

May 01, 2019

 

Profits: Vodafone Qatar’s profits climbed to QR 43.54 million in the first quarter of 2019, an increase of 149%, compared to QR 17.46 million in the same quarter of 2018. Vodafone did not record any assessment differences in the statement of comprehensive income for the first quarter of the current year.

 

Revenues & Profits: increased by 0.60% to QR 535.1 million, compared to QR 531.9 million in 2018. However, the company was able to significantly reduce operating costs, especially those related to networks and rentals, which reflected positively on profitability. Earnings before interest, tax, depreciation and amortization (EBITDA) amounted to QR 180.6 million in the first quarter of 2019, an increase of QR 46 million, compared to QR 134.6 million in the corresponding quarter of last year.

 

Financing Costs: increased during the first quarter of 2019 to reach QR 6.0 million, compared to QR 1.1 million for the same period in 2018, as a result of increased company obligations and rising interest rates.
